Appeal Court Upholds Nullification of Ebonyi Local Government Elections

The Court of Appeal sitting in Enugu has affirmed the nullification of the 2022 Local Government elections in Ebonyi State.
Delivering the lead judgment on Thursday, Justice Joseph Ekanem upheld the earlier ruling by Justice R.O. Riman of the Federal High Court in Abakaliki, which had invalidated the elections. The Appeal Court dismissed three separate appeals filed by the Ebonyi State Government, the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N), and the affected Local Government Chairmen.
The appellate court held that the initial Federal High Court judgment (Suit No. FHC/AI/CS/224/2022) was aimed at enforcing compliance with an earlier judgment (Suit No. FHC/AI/CS/151/2022), contrary to the appellants’ claims.
According to the court, the appeals failed due to a “proliferation of issues for determination,” which rendered the appellants’ briefs incompetent.
The three appeals included:
- CA/E/381/2022 – Hon. Nwogba Ebere Oboh & 12 others vs. Otu Collins Eleri & 12 others: Dismissed in line with the Federal High Court’s earlier ruling.
- CA/E/176/2023 – CBN vs. Otu Collins Eleri & 22 others: Partially succeeded. The court ruled that Local Government funds from the Federation Account must be released, but cannot be accessed or spent by the appellants, who were not validly elected.
- CA/E/266/2023 – Governor of Ebonyi State & two others vs. Otu Collins Eleri & 22 others: Dismissed for lack of merit. The court reaffirmed that the July 30, 2022, LG elections in Ebonyi were null and void.
With this ruling, the Federal High Court’s decision nullifying the election of Local Government Chairmen and Councillors in Ebonyi State remains in force.
